The Importance of Fleet Cybersecurity
Fleet cybersecurity is crucial to prevent unauthorized access to sensitive data, protect against malware and other cyber threats, and ensure the integrity of fleet operations. A single cyber attack can compromise the entire fleet, leading to significant financial losses, damage to reputation, and even put the safety of drivers and other road users at risk. Best Practices for Fleet Cybersecurity
To protect their fleets from cyber threats, fleet managers and safety directors should implement the following best practices:
- Implement robust passwords and authentication protocols to prevent unauthorized access to fleet systems and data
- Regularly update and patch fleet software and systems to prevent vulnerabilities
- Use firewalls and other security measures to protect against malware and other cyber threats
- Monitor fleet systems and data for suspicious activity and respond quickly to potential threats
- Provide training to drivers and other personnel on cybersecurity best practices and the importance of protecting fleet data
